鄭州上街區(qū)鄭州單片機(jī)培訓(xùn)班推薦,今天和朋友聊天,無意間聽到鄭州單片機(jī)培訓(xùn)最近很火,在網(wǎng)絡(luò)上了解了一下關(guān)于它的一些介紹單片機(jī)的應(yīng)用,單片機(jī)是怎么運(yùn)轉(zhuǎn)的,單片機(jī)的學(xué)習(xí)過程,單片機(jī)C語言基礎(chǔ),C語言的編程特點(diǎn),單片機(jī)MCU的組成。
1.單片機(jī)的應(yīng)用
為什么叫單片機(jī)呢,找找他的對立面,不叫單片機(jī)的,同類的事物:計(jì)算機(jī)(問這個(gè)問題可能你還沒有意識到,單片機(jī)是個(gè)計(jì)算機(jī)系統(tǒng)),在他出現(xiàn)之前,有什么,計(jì)算機(jī),其實(shí)以前很早的計(jì)算機(jī)相對來說很簡單,主要的部件:一個(gè)CPU 加一個(gè)程序存儲(chǔ)器和一個(gè),輸入輸出可不是今天的鍵盤和顯示器,而且應(yīng)用有很大局限性。
2.單片機(jī)是怎么運(yùn)轉(zhuǎn)的
首先作為控制系統(tǒng)需要一臺計(jì)算機(jī)來進(jìn)行運(yùn)轉(zhuǎn),你用傳統(tǒng)的計(jì)算機(jī)試一下,非常不方便,而且傳統(tǒng)計(jì)算機(jī)的CPU 那個(gè)芯片真的就是CPU在了里面,當(dāng)然后面也有了集成RAM 和CPU的SOC了。這樣就誕生專門用來做控制系統(tǒng)的計(jì)算機(jī)系統(tǒng)了,性能低,成本低,再集成一些控制常用的外設(shè)IO,定時(shí)器,ADC,DCA等,就不需要鼠標(biāo)鍵盤顯示器了,這樣主要用于低成本控制系統(tǒng)的計(jì)算機(jī)就誕生了---單片機(jī)。
3.單片機(jī)的學(xué)習(xí)過程
很多小伙伴喜歡先系統(tǒng)學(xué)一遍,*才做項(xiàng)目。如果你有足夠的毅力可以這么做,但很多人都沒有。很多人在學(xué)習(xí)過程中也是感到枯燥的,說白了就是缺少那種及時(shí)反饋,或者叫成就感。C語言是學(xué)完了基本的語句這個(gè)時(shí)候我完全可以先做一個(gè)有意思的東西。
4.單片機(jī)C語言基礎(chǔ)
C語言是單片機(jī)開發(fā)的必備基礎(chǔ),也是一定要學(xué)的,但是單片機(jī)的C語言和純C語言開發(fā)相比學(xué)的東西要少很多,也正是因?yàn)檫@樣剛剛學(xué)習(xí)單片機(jī)的朋友不要看到要學(xué)習(xí)C語言就開始發(fā)怵,其實(shí)這個(gè)是沒有必要的,其學(xué)習(xí)深度是不一樣的,多以不要過于擔(dān)心
5.C語言的編程特點(diǎn)
由于C語言通過寄存器和硬件驅(qū)動(dòng)/接口建立關(guān)系,編程者不用再去記憶枯燥的指令,而編程語言也更加層次化,模塊化編程也大大提高了代碼的可讀性。相比于匯編來說C語言可以用少量的代碼實(shí)現(xiàn)一些復(fù)雜的功能,而且還更易于理解。這也是C語言越來越受歡迎的原因。
6.單片機(jī)MCU的組成
運(yùn)算器:首先要有進(jìn)行運(yùn)算的部件,這就是“運(yùn)算器”(ALU 算術(shù)/邏輯運(yùn)算部件);存儲(chǔ)器:其次還有能存儲(chǔ)記憶的作用。運(yùn)作器件還有一些原始的題目,這類器件就稱為“存貯器”(RAM、ROM、EPROM、EEPROM等等)。
好了 小編將關(guān)于單片機(jī)的應(yīng)用,單片機(jī)是怎么運(yùn)轉(zhuǎn)的,單片機(jī)的學(xué)習(xí)過程,單片機(jī)C語言基礎(chǔ),C語言的編程特點(diǎn),單片機(jī)MCU的組成都毫無保留的分享給大家了,希望大家積極踴躍的發(fā)表自己的意見,小編都會(huì)虛心接受哦。鄭州上街區(qū)鄭州單片機(jī)培訓(xùn)班推薦
尊重原創(chuàng)文章,轉(zhuǎn)載請注明出處與鏈接:http://waimaoniu.net.cn/news_show_5979574/,違者必究!